Module 1 - Introduction to Computers - Macintosh OS
Lesson 2 - Operating System and Desktop
Section 1 - Introduction
Computers use the operating system to manage all the related tasks needed to run the computer and its input and output devices. The Macintosh operating system translates information into a graphical user interface (GUI) that is easier to understand. The GUI allows the user to input information by clicking icons or symbols rather than typing lines of code. One of the major components of the GUI on the Macintosh operating system is the desktop.

In this lesson you will be provided with general information about how operating systems work, and then you will learn about the desktop for the Macintosh OS.
